Characterization of catechol derivative removal by lignin peroxidase in aqueous mixture.
The use of lignin peroxidase (LIP) as an alternative method for the removal of four catechols (1,2-dihydroxybenzene): catechol (CAT), 4-chlorocatechol (4-CC), 4,5-dichlorocatechol (4,5-DCC) and 4-methylcatechol (4-MC) typical pollutants in wastewater derived from oil and paper industries, was evaluated. متن کاملAdsorption properties of ionic species on cross-linked chitosans modified with catechol and salicylic acid moieties.
Catechol-type chitosan resin and salicylic acid-type chitosan resin were easily synthesized for use in estimating the adsorption behavior of 34 elements at pH 1 - 7 in aquatic media. متن کاملPhenolic Moieties in Lignins
The use of 2-chloro-4,4,5,5-tetramethyl-1,3,2-dioxaphospholane as a phosphitylation reagent in quantitative 31P NMR analysis of the hydroxyl groups in lignins has been thoroughly examined, and an experimental protocol recommended for spectra acquisition has been developed. Quantitative analysis of six “standard lignins” gave results comparable to those obtained by other methods of analysis. Exc...
متن کاملIron Absorption by Enzymically Isolated Leaf Cells'
The rate of Fe absorption by cells enzymically isolated from tobacco leaves is corre'ated with the age of the leaves from which the cells are derived4 The cells obtained from younger leaves absorb Fe more rapidly than those from older ones. متن کاملEnzymically Induced Changes in the Turbidity of Starch Solutions*
The usual methods for detecting the action of amylolytic enzymes on starch are confined to three types of measurements: (1) increase in reducing action; (2) decrease in viscosity; and (3) decrease in the color of the resulting dextrin-iodine complex.
